Why Protein Matters for Muscle Growth
Protein is the primary dietary building block your body uses to repair and grow muscle tissue. Resistance training creates tiny disruptions in muscle fibers; in response, your body ramps up muscle protein synthesis (MPS)—the process of rebuilding those fibers bigger and stronger. To support that process, you need enough total protein, the right balance of essential amino acids (especially leucine), and an overall diet that supports training and recovery.
It’s also important to note that protein doesn’t work in isolation. Training provides the stimulus, protein provides the materials, and total calories, sleep, and consistency determine how well the process plays out over weeks and months.
How Much Protein Do You Need for Muscle Growth?
Protein needs vary based on body size, training volume, age, and whether you’re cutting, maintaining, or bulking. While the “one-size-fits-all” numbers are popular, the most useful approach is to think in ranges and adjust based on results (strength progression, body composition, recovery, and hunger).
General Daily Protein Targets (Evidence-Based Ranges)
For most people lifting weights regularly, these ranges are practical and widely supported by research and coaching experience:
- General muscle growth (most lifters): 1.6–2.2 g/kg of body weight per day (about 0.7–1.0 g/lb).
- Fat loss while maintaining muscle: 1.8–2.7 g/kg (about 0.8–1.2 g/lb), especially if you’re leaner or training hard in a calorie deficit.
- Beginners or casual lifters: Often do well near the lower end (around 1.6 g/kg) if calories and training are consistent.
- Older adults: May benefit from the higher end due to “anabolic resistance” (a reduced MPS response to protein).
Quick example: A 75 kg (165 lb) lifter aiming for growth might target 120–165 g of protein daily.
Does More Protein Always Mean More Muscle?
Not necessarily. Once you consistently hit an effective range, piling on extra protein tends to produce diminishing returns for hypertrophy. More can still be useful for appetite control during cutting or if it helps you reach your calorie target with minimally processed foods. But if extremely high protein crowds out carbs and fats, performance and recovery can suffer—especially for high-volume training.
Protein Timing: When Should You Eat Protein?
Total daily protein is the #1 priority, but timing can help you get more out of your intake—particularly if you train hard or want to optimize recovery.
How to Distribute Protein Across the Day
A strong, simple strategy is to spread protein fairly evenly across meals. This supports multiple “peaks” of MPS throughout the day.
- Aim for 3–5 protein-containing meals per day.
- Most people do well with 25–45 g of high-quality protein per meal (larger athletes may need more).
- Try to avoid having almost all your protein at dinner if your goal is maximizing muscle growth.
Pre- and Post-Workout Protein: What Matters Most
The idea of a tiny “anabolic window” is overstated, but protein around training is still helpful. A practical approach:
- Pre-workout: Eat a protein-rich meal 1–3 hours before training (for example, Greek yogurt with fruit, chicken and rice, or tofu stir-fry).
- Post-workout: Get another protein dose within about 0–2 hours after training—especially if you trained fasted or your pre-workout meal was small.
If you’re already eating enough protein across the day, your post-workout shake is convenient, not mandatory.
Protein Before Bed: Worth It?
For many lifters, a pre-bed protein snack can be a simple way to increase daily intake and support overnight recovery. Slower-digesting proteins (like casein-rich dairy) are often recommended, but what matters most is hitting your daily total. Options include cottage cheese, Greek yogurt, or a protein shake if that’s easier.
Protein Quality: What Are the Best Sources?
High-quality proteins provide all essential amino acids in adequate amounts and are easier to use for muscle repair. You can absolutely build muscle with a mix of animal and plant proteins—the key is planning.
Animal-Based Protein Options
- Lean meats: chicken, turkey, lean beef, pork tenderloin
- Fish and seafood: salmon, tuna, cod, shrimp (bonus: omega-3s in fatty fish)
- Eggs: nutrient-dense and versatile
- Dairy: Greek yogurt, cottage cheese, milk, kefir
These sources are typically complete proteins and tend to be rich in leucine, a key amino acid involved in triggering MPS.
Plant-Based Protein Options (and How to Make Them Work)
- Soy foods: tofu, tempeh, edamame
- Legumes: lentils, chickpeas, beans
- Grains and pseudo-grains: quinoa, oats
- Seitan: very high protein (gluten-based)
- Plant protein powders: pea, soy, rice blends
Plant proteins can be slightly less dense in certain essential amino acids, so it helps to:
- Eat a variety of sources across the day (e.g., beans + rice, tofu + quinoa).
- Consider slightly higher total protein if your diet is mostly plant-based.
- Use convenient boosters like soy milk, edamame, or a quality plant protein powder to hit your targets.
Do You Need Protein Supplements?
Supplements are optional. Whole foods can cover your needs, but protein powders are an efficient tool when appetite, time, or budget gets in the way.
Whey vs. Casein vs. Plant Protein
- Whey: fast-digesting, high in leucine, convenient post-workout.
- Casein: slower-digesting, popular for evening intake.
- Plant blends: often combine sources (pea + rice) for a more complete amino acid profile.
Choose the option you tolerate well and will use consistently. Look for third-party testing if you want extra assurance about quality.
Common Mistakes That Limit Muscle Growth
- Only tracking “protein days” sporadically: consistency across weeks matters more than perfection on one day.
- Skimping on calories: building muscle is harder if you’re under-eating—especially carbs that support training performance.
- Relying on one giant protein meal: spreading intake usually works better for stimulating MPS multiple times per day.
- Ignoring sleep and recovery: even perfect macros can’t fully compensate for poor sleep.
- Assuming supplements replace training: progressive overload and adequate volume are still the drivers.
Practical Ways to Hit Your Protein Target
If you struggle to reach your daily goal, small changes add up quickly:
- Anchor each meal with a protein source (e.g., eggs at breakfast, chicken or tofu at lunch, fish at dinner).
- Use high-protein snacks like Greek yogurt, cottage cheese, jerky, edamame, or a shake.
- Upgrade staples: choose higher-protein bread/wraps, add lentils to pasta sauce, or mix protein powder into oats.
- Plan for busy days: keep easy options on hand (canned tuna/salmon, rotisserie chicken, tofu, protein bars you enjoy).
Conclusion
For muscle growth, aim for a consistent daily protein intake in the neighborhood of 1.6–2.2 g/kg, spread across 3–5 meals, and supported by hard training and adequate calories. Choose protein sources you enjoy, prioritize quality and variety, and use supplements only as a convenient tool—not a requirement. Do that consistently, and your nutrition will actively support the work you put in at the gym.
